### Introducing the Arbitrator
This release introduces a high availability (HA), zero downtime deployment default. The new topology adds a lightweight [arbitrator node](http://galeracluster.
com/documentation-webpages/arbitrator.html) to the two node MySQL cluster. The addition of the arbitrator node builds on the native strength of horizontal scaling by exposing the MariaDB/Galera combination for HA support.
While the typical minimal HA configuration includes [three](cluster-behavior.md#avoid-an-even-number-of-nodes) full-size MySQL nodes, the new default reduces some of that overhead with the lightweight arbitrator node. The presence of the arbitrator avoids the possibility of a [split-brain condition](http://galeracluster.com/documentation-webpages/weightedquorum.html#split-brain-condition) by participating in [weighted quorum elections](http://galeracluster.com/documentation-webpages/weightedquorum.html)
